TE's Data and Device business unit seeks an experienced Account Manager to join our Enterprise sales team for one of our top enterprise accounts. As an Account Manager, you will work closely with another Account Manager and report directly to the Global Account Manager, driving account growth through relationship building, securing new design wins, and conducting market share analysis.
Job Location: This person must be in the San Jose Bay Area.
Key Responsibilities:
- Meet customers in the Bay Area locally and frequently.
- Build and maintain critical relationships with the Customer's Engineering teams locally in the Bay Area and Austin, as well as with extended teams in Asia.
- Become the application expert and be able to present Customer application solution designs and future technical trends to stakeholders.
- Drive new and custom designs in coordination with internal and external teams.
- Support Salesforce pipeline entries, S&OP forecasting, and related revenue tools.
- Provide regular updates and reports on account performance, growth opportunities, and strategic initiatives.
Job Requirements:
- Familiarity and experience selling to enterprise customers are strongly preferred.
- Knowledge of Cloud architecture (server, switch, storage, AI, related ICs, and protocols).
- A BS degree in engineering or equivalent industry experience is preferred.
- Background in interconnects, copper cables, and optics is strongly preferred.
- 5 to 7 years of industry experience in customer-facing roles.
- Ability to work cross-functionally in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
- Strong presentation and interpersonal skills.
- Proficiency in PowerPoint and Excel.
About TE Connectivity
TE Connectivity plc (NYSE: TEL) is a global industrial technology leader creating a safer, sustainable, productive, and connected future. As a trusted innovation partner, our broad range of connectivity and sensor solutions enable the distribution of power, signal and data to advance next-generation transportation, energy networks, automated factories, data centers enabling artificial intelligence, and more. Our more than 90,000 employees, including 10,000 engineers, work alongside customers in approximately 130 countries.
